What is electrical instrumentation engineering?

Electrical Instrumentation Engineering is a specialized field that focuses on the design, development, installation, and maintenance of instruments and devices used to measure and control electrical systems and processes. Professionals in this field ensure the accuracy and reliability of equipment that monitors variables such as voltage, current, pressure, temperature, and flow in industrial and manufacturing settings. They play a crucial role in automating processes, improving efficiency, and maintaining safety standards in industries like power generation, oil and gas, pharmaceuticals, and manufacturing.

What are some typical challenges electrical instrumentation engineers face when working on large-scale industrial projects?

Electrical Instrumentation Engineers often encounter challenges such as integrating new instrumentation systems with existing legacy equipment, ensuring compliance with strict industry safety and regulatory standards, and managing tight project timelines. Collaboration with multidisciplinary teams—including process engineers, electricians, and project managers—is key to overcoming these obstacles. Effective troubleshooting skills and adaptability are crucial, as unexpected technical issues or supply chain delays can arise during installation and commissioning phases.

What are the key skills and qualifications needed to thrive as an electrical instrumentation engineer, and why are they important?

To thrive as an Electrical Instrumentation Engineer, you need a solid background in electrical engineering principles, process control, and instrumentation, often supported by a bachelor's degree in electrical or instrumentation engineering. Familiarity with PLCs, DCS, SCADA systems, and relevant certifications such as ISA CAP or EIT are typically required. Strong problem-solving abilities, attention to detail, and effective communication skills help you excel in cross-functional teams and complex environments. These skills ensure safe, reliable, and optimized operation of automated and industrial systems.

What does an electrical instrumentation engineer do?

An electrical instrumentation engineer designs, develops, and maintains control systems and instrumentation used in industrial processes. They work with sensors, controllers, and automation equipment to ensure accurate measurement and control of electrical and electronic systems, often using tools like PLCs and SCADA systems. Their role involves troubleshooting, calibration, and ensuring safety standards in environments such as manufacturing plants and power facilities.
